Consider a nine -year moving average used to smooth a time series that was first recorded in 1961. a. Which year serves as the f
kirill [66]

Answer:

  a.  1965

  b.  8 years

Step-by-step explanation:

For answers to questions like these it can work to consider the smallest possible dataset.

<h3>Dataset</h3>

For our purpose, consider the 9 years/values to be averaged to be ...

  1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8 ,9

<h3>Observations</h3>

a. The center value of the data set is 5. Its number is 5-1=4 more than the first one.

The first centered value is from the year 1961 +4 = 1965.

b. The 4 values at the beginning, and the 4 values at the end do not have a corresponding "average" value. That is, 4+4 = 8 values in the series are lost with respect to the number of average values.

8 years of values are lost.
